QUALIFICATIONS:

High school diploma/GED. College degree or certificate preferred in digital media, technology, marketing, or related field. Must possess a valid driver’s license. Must meet Park Board employment and physical standards, which may include a background check as well as drug and alcohol screening. Experience and training which demonstrates the knowledge, skills, and aptitude to perform the defined duties.

PERFORMANCE RESPONSIBILITIES

Serves as a member of the CPRST marketing team, attending all meetings. Posts content to social media pages as assigned, as well as submits a schedule for review and approval weekly. Manages public interactions through social media posts and private messages. Assists with SEO strategy and key word usage in content. Takes pictures at parks, programs, and events as assigned. Provides regular reports on social media, and other digital content. Acts as a member of the Recreation Team for special events, programs, and other activities. Acts as a team member with other Parks and Recreation staff, embracing and supporting the vision and mission of the CPRST Board of Directors and the City of Cullman. Attends all meetings as required by the Executive Director. Exhibits a high level of professionalism and ethics, working amicably with the Park Board, the Executive Director, Administrators, Personnel, and Community. Exhibits proficiency in written and oral communication. Work hours may vary, which will likely include nights and weekends, with hours varying based on time of year, events, and projects. Performs other duties as assigned by supervisors.

WORKING ENVIRONMENT

The work area is well lighted, ventilated, and heated. Occasionally work outdoors where there is a potential to be exposed to various weather conditions.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S

; Often working in the office at a desk as well as going out to take pictures in outdoor parks and indoor facilities. Must be able to occasionally lift up to forty pounds as well as sit, stand, stoop, or walk for long periods of time.
